Article 7: WARRANTY
The guarantee of ROLAND PONS is that provided for by the consumer code mentioned in articles L211-4 to L211-13 of this code and that relating to defects in the thing sold under the conditions provided for in articles 1641 to 1648 and 2232 of the civil code.
– Article L. 211-4 of the Consumer Code:
“The seller is obligated to deliver goods that conform to the contract and is liable for any lack of conformity existing at the time of delivery. The seller is also liable for any lack of conformity resulting from the packaging, assembly instructions, or installation when the latter was the seller’s responsibility under the contract or was carried out under the seller’s supervision.”
– Article L. 211-5 of the Consumer Code:
“To be compliant with the contract, the goods must:”
1/ be fit for the purpose for which goods of the same type are normally used and, where applicable:
– correspond to the description given by the seller and possess the qualities that the seller presented to the buyer in the form of a sample or model
– to possess the qualities that a buyer can legitimately expect, given the public statements made by the seller, particularly in advertising or labelling
2/ Or possess the characteristics defined by mutual agreement between the parties or be suitable for any special purpose sought by the buyer, brought to the seller’s attention and accepted by the latter.
– Article L.211-12 of the Consumer Code:
“The action resulting from the lack of conformity is time-barred after two years from the delivery of the goods.”
– 1641 of the Civil Code:
“The seller is bound by a warranty against hidden defects in the thing sold which render it unfit for its intended use, or which diminish that use to such an extent that the buyer would not have acquired it, or would have given only a lower price, if he had known of them.”
– Article 1648, paragraph 1 of the Civil Code:
“The action resulting from latent defects must be brought by the buyer within two years of the discovery of the defect.”
